Goo Gone Grout & Tile Cleaner is a 28-ounce EPA Safer Choice certified liquid formula designed to remove tough stains caused by mold, mildew, soap scum, and hard water. Safe for use on grout, ceramic, porcelain, stone, and fiberglass surfaces, it combines powerful cleaning with a fresh citrus scent to restore your tiles to spotless perfection.

Wow! I was pleasantly surprised how well this worked! I applied it to my stained grout, let it sit for 10 minutes, and it lifted almost all grime the first time. I applied a small amount for a second clean and it lifted all built up grime. There was some serious build up! I would highly recommend and will continue to use when cleaning to maintain clean grout lines. A little goes a long way, and I didn’t have to scrub every line of grout!

Used this with steamer and a grout brush.Took a good while to do and some elbow grease but so worth it. I used the entire bottle for a large floor area. Sprayed an area and let it soak in. Brushed grout with the brush. Then the steamer.Last step was using old towels to mop up the water from steaming.Ordered another bottle to do bathroom grout.It works very well.
